;pIC16f627鍵盤顯示+E2PROM存取+模擬I2C總線通信等模塊示例程序;已經(jīng)調(diào)試通過,愿與各位初學者共享listp=16f627;listdirectivetodefineprocessor#include;__CONFIG(_INCRC_OSC_NOCLKOUT&_MCLRE_OFF&_LV
據(jù)悉,微軟所申請的這項專利名為“Thin Keyboard Device”(薄鍵盤設備),內(nèi)容主要展示了配備更薄鍵盤設備以及將鍵盤厚度降低的方法,專利編號10090121,是一項技術專利。微軟于當?shù)貢r間2018年3月22日正式向美國專利商標局(USPTO)提出了專利申請,在2018年10月2日正式得到審評通過。美國專利商標局于本周一正式公示了這項專利。
4×4小鍵盤的典型數(shù)字接口使用8個數(shù)字I/O引腳。但使用8個引腳作為數(shù)字I/O會占用可用于連接LCD的段驅(qū)動器引腳的數(shù)量。 通過使用2個數(shù)字I/O引腳和2個模擬輸入引腳,可以向PIC單片機添加一個4×4小
#include\"../Inc/MyCommon.h\"#include#include#include\"../Inc/MyDelay.h\"#include\"../Inc/CH451.h\"#definePS2SDA(1
AVR單片機鍵盤子程序鍵盤掃描有中斷方式和查詢方式#include"jn8515def.h"/******以下是鍵盤排列圖******|||PC0___1|__2|__3|__|||PC1___4|__5|__6|__|||PC2___7|__8|__9|__|||PC3___C|__0|__S|__||||||
#include__CONFIG(0x1832);constcharTABLE[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0X82,0XF8,0X80,0X90};//定義常數(shù)0-9的數(shù)據(jù)表格volatileunsignedcharresult=0,temp=0,f=0;volatileunsignedinttotal=0,ge=
羅技剛剛推出了 K600 TV Keyboard 無線鍵盤新品,顧名思義,它擁有為控制智能電視和電腦采用的獨特設計。K600 最大的特點,就是在右側(cè)集成了一個圓形觸控板區(qū)域,以及專屬的媒體和導航鍵(包括主頁、音量、方向),所以你也可以將它當做一款高級遙控器來使用。
鍵盤的應用和分類:鍵盤分為編碼鍵盤和非編碼鍵盤,鍵盤上閉合鍵的識別是由專門的硬件編碼器實現(xiàn),并產(chǎn)生鍵編碼號或者是鍵值的成為編碼鍵盤,如計算機的鍵盤靠軟件編程來識別的稱為非編碼鍵盤;在單片機組成的各種系
與單片機交互,鍵盤可能是最直接的工具了。所以我對于鍵盤檢測也是十分期待的。鍵盤說開了,其實就是很多的按鈕。如果鍵盤數(shù)比較小的話,直接使用IO口連接按鈕就可以了,比如我要實現(xiàn)一個功能,按鍵使數(shù)字加1或減1,
#include__CONFIG(0x1832);constcharTABLE[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0X82,0XF8,0X80,0X90};//定義常數(shù)0-9的數(shù)據(jù)表格 volatileunsignedcharresult=0,temp=0,f=0;volatileunsignedinttotal=0,ge
作業(yè)1:數(shù)碼管前三位數(shù)顯示一個跑表,從000到999,之間以百分之一秒的速度運行,當按下key1時跑表停止,再次按下時跑表開始#include#define uint unsigned int#define uchar unsigned charsbit dula =P2^6;sbit wela
//程序中沒有做按鍵去抖,也沒有考慮多個鍵同時按下的情況。//最低兩位數(shù)碼管顯示相應的按鍵(如按下S10,在顯示10;按下S25,則顯示25)//無按鍵按下的時候顯示FF//按鍵跟按鍵的掃描結果滿足如下關系:
//按鍵跟按鍵的掃描結果滿足如下關系://按鍵掃描結果(result)按鍵掃描結果//K100XE7K180XB7//K110XEBK190XBB//K120XEDK200XBD//K130XEEK210XBE//K140XD7K220X77//K150XDBK230X7B//K160XDDK240X7D//K